Tunceli is in danger - a warning from a geologist

Perhaps I am expressing them here for the first time. Tunceli is in danger. Although no one talks about that region today, there is a danger.

Axar.az reports that Naji Gorur, a famous Turkish geologist and professor at Istanbul Technical University, said this while giving statements about the seismic map of Turkiye.

"Between Erzincan and Karliova there is the Yediova fault. This subterranean thrust last occurred in 1790, it has the potential to create seismic activity every 250 years. The day is getting closer. We are especially waiting for the place where Pulimur is, between Erzincan and Karliova. This benefit if seismic activity wakes up, a 7.4-magnitude earthquake can occur. It is not far from Tunceli. It is also surrounded by a seismically active fault from the west. The Yedisu fault is considered particularly dangerous. It is very close to time, no joke. We cannot say anything concrete about the exact time. We don't know the recurrence period," the geologist said.
